Output eeb8d91a2eee0d1b56ee161d8564db1d2a0f07c6c6de277123d627e70af0ed8b:2

value
19815070
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ea7fe7932d6b6c21f09c7d47c2c5a067922b15d6 OP_EQUAL
address
3P4wGQ5eT6R4G6nFBifuT78MrDH9eGwKsp
transaction
eeb8d91a2eee0d1b56ee161d8564db1d2a0f07c6c6de277123d627e70af0ed8b
confirmations
96870
spent
true